How do they match: Health and Safety Engineers, Except Mining Safety Engineers and Inspectors

  • Fire Prevention Engineer

  • Design and build safety equipment.
  • Evaluate product designs for safety.
  • Investigate industrial accidents, injuries, or occupational diseases to determine causes and preventive measures.
  • Participate in preparation of product usage and precautionary label instructions.
  • Recommend procedures for detection, prevention, and elimination of physical, chemical, or other product hazards.
  • Review plans and specifications for construction of new machinery or equipment to determine whether all safety requirements have been met.
